Avisford Park Hotel is seeking a Kitchen Porter to support the kitchen team in a busy hotel setting. You will help keep the kitchen clean, assist with basic food preparation, and ensure stock is rotated and deliveries are put away.
Ideal candidates have hospitality experience or are eager to learn, a good work ethic, and the ability to work quickly in a fast-paced environment. In return, you will join a friendly team with meals on duty and staff discounts.
Avisford Park Hotel is located within 60 acres of grounds with 140 bedrooms, 15 meeting rooms and a fully equipped gym and leisure club and golf course for guests to enjoy, something for everyone.
